Storyline

<p>A greedy bars the villagers from using Thamaraikulam, the village tank. Under the leadership of Chellaiah, the son of a landowner, the villagers organise a revolution. Chellaiah goes to to seek help from his friend Sekhar. A series of complications follow which include the heroine being kidnapped and tortured, and Sekhar murdered. How Chellaiah and the villagers solve these problems forms the rest of the story. Credits adapted from : was produced under the banner Kalyani Pictures. Writer S. R. Natarajan and cinematographer S. R. Veerabahu were the producers, and was director. , then a struggling actor, was noticed by Srinivasan during a play in . Srinivasan, impressed with Nagesh’s comic performance, hired him to act in another comic role in , for a salary of 2500, though Nagesh revealed that the production company did not pay him the intended salary. The film thus became Nagesh’s cinematic acting debut. S. M. Ramkumar and Kameswaran served as the dance choreographers. Shooting took place at the now non-existent Golden Studios. The music was composed by H. Padmanabha Sarma and T. A. Mothi. The playback singers were , Mothi, , , S. C. Krishnan, A. P. Komala and ‘Nellore’ Janaki. was released on 14 April 1959. The film, which was written with themes, was not well received by viewers because, according to historian , “Tamil cinema was then dominated by movies of with accent on high-flown, alliterative dialogue”. Nagesh’s performance was panned by the Tamil magazine . Kanthan of the magazine appreciated Srinivasan’s direction and said the film could be watched once only for Radha’s performance.</p>
